Since 1995 Accel has been a leader in the contract packaging and assembly industry. The staff at Accel come from unusually diverse demographic backgrounds. The company is 42.8% female and 39.7% ethnic minorities. Despite its diversity in other areas, Accel employees are noticeably lacking in political diversity. It has an unusually high proportion of employees who are members of the Democratic Party, at 72.0%. Employees seem to enjoy working in an otherwise diverse workplace that is dominated by members of the Democratic Party. Accel has great employee retention with staff members usually staying with the company for 3.5 years.Based in Ohio, Accel is a small finance company with only 200 employees and an annual revenue of $30.2M.

Accel has 200 employees.
43% of Accel employees are women, while 57% are men.
The most common ethnicity at Accel is White (60%).
14% of Accel employees are Hispanic or Latino.
11% of Accel employees are Asian.
The average employee at Accel makes $65,109 per year.
Accel employees are most likely to be members of the democratic party.
Employees at Accel stay with the company for 3.5 years on average.
